Tar mats often form in high-permeability sections of the reservoir, impacting pressure support, aquifer sweep, and well placement strategies.
A reservoir simulation is shown to model the formation of the tar mat and associated viscous oil. The importance of reservoir architecture and petrophysical parameters is indicated in this process, explaining areal variations in tar mats. The resulting new workflow is a rapidly emerging, powerful new method to optimize field development planning.
